4. Materials Security
Materials security is a paramount consideration within the design and manufacturing of toddler mobility gadgets, instantly influencing the well being and well-being of the kid. The supplies utilized in these gadgets should be rigorously assessed to make sure they don’t pose any potential hurt by means of direct contact, ingestion, or inhalation.
-
Non-Poisonous Parts
The collection of non-toxic supplies is important to mitigate the chance of chemical publicity. Supplies generally used embody plastics, metals, and materials, all of which should adjust to stringent security requirements. For instance, plastics must be freed from phthalates and BPA, chemical compounds identified to disrupt endocrine perform. Metals must be examined for lead content material and different heavy metals that may trigger developmental issues. Materials must be freed from allergenic dyes and flame retardants. Compliance with laws reminiscent of EN 71 and ASTM F963 ensures that the supplies used within the gadget meet established security benchmarks. Failure to make use of non-toxic elements can lead to persistent well being points for the toddler.

Continuously Requested Questions
This part addresses frequent inquiries concerning toddler mobility gadgets, providing readability on security, utilization, and developmental issues.
Query 1: At what age is an toddler mobility gadget acceptable to be used?
The suitable age varies relying on particular person developmental milestones. Infants ought to exhibit ample neck and trunk management, sometimes round 6-9 months, earlier than utilizing such a tool. Untimely use might hinder correct muscle improvement.
Query 2: How can security be ensured when utilizing an toddler mobility gadget?
Supervision is paramount. Make sure the gadget is used on a degree floor, away from stairs or different hazards. Repeatedly examine the gadget for free components or injury. Adherence to manufacturer-recommended weight limits can be important.
Query 3: Are there potential developmental drawbacks to utilizing toddler mobility gadgets?
Extended use might impede the pure improvement of core muscle groups and stability. It’s endorsed to restrict utilization to quick intervals and encourage different types of flooring play that promote impartial motion.
Query 4: What options must be prioritized when choosing an toddler mobility gadget?
Stability, adjustability, and the presence of a dependable braking mechanism are crucial. Materials security and ease of cleansing are additionally necessary elements. Interactive options must be age-appropriate and non-overstimulating.
Query 5: How ought to an toddler be launched to a mobility gadget?
A gradual introduction is advisable. Enable the toddler to familiarize themselves with the gadget in a stationary place earlier than encouraging motion. Present assist and encouragement because the toddler begins to make use of the gadget.
Query 6: What are the cleansing and upkeep necessities for an toddler mobility gadget?
Common cleansing with delicate detergents is really helpful to take care of hygiene. Examine for free components or injury usually and tackle any points promptly. Seek advice from the producer’s directions for particular cleansing and upkeep pointers.

Efficient Utilization of Toddler Mobility Units
The following pointers present insights into maximizing the advantages and minimizing the dangers related to toddler mobility gadgets. These gadgets must be thought to be instruments to reinforce, not exchange, pure developmental development.
Tip 1: Monitor Utilization Period: Toddler mobility gadget utilization must be restricted to quick intervals, sometimes 15-20 minutes per session. Prolonged utilization might impede improvement of core muscle groups and stability abilities.
Tip 2: Supervise Actively: Direct supervision is non-negotiable. An toddler ought to by no means be left unattended whereas utilizing an toddler mobility gadget. Environmental hazards must be recognized and mitigated earlier than use.
Tip 3: Guarantee Correct Match and Adjustment: The gadget must be accurately adjusted to the toddler’s peak and developmental stage. Handles must be at a snug attain, and seat heights, if relevant, ought to enable toes to make contact with the ground.
Tip 4: Prioritize Security Options: When choosing a tool, prioritize fashions with strong security options, together with steady bases, braking mechanisms, and non-toxic supplies. Regulatory compliance (e.g., ASTM F963) must be verified.
Tip 5: Encourage Different Actions: Toddler mobility gadget utilization must be complemented with different floor-based actions that promote crawling, rolling, and impartial motion. A balanced strategy is important for holistic improvement.
Tip 6: Choose Applicable Terrain: Toddler mobility gadgets must be utilized on easy, degree surfaces, free from obstacles or potential hazards. Use on uneven terrain will increase the chance of tipping or damage.
